Step 1
Back Cover
- Remove the Samsung S-Pen stylus.
- Remove the micro SD storage card.
Remove the Samsung S-Pen stylus.
Remove the micro SD storage card.

Step 2
- Using the plastic opening tool, start where the S-pen was located and carefully pry up the corner.
Using the plastic opening tool, start where the S-pen was located and carefully pry up the corner.
Step 3
- Work your way around the entire device by carefully prying and sliding the plastic opening tool.
- There are clips approximately 2cm apart. As you are removing the back cover you should hear the clips being dislocated from the tablet.
Work your way around the entire device by carefully prying and sliding the plastic opening tool.
There are clips approximately 2cm apart. As you are removing the back cover you should hear the clips being dislocated from the tablet.
To reassemble your device, follow these instructions in reverse order.
